Why Live in Oak Garden

Oak Garden, located east of downtown Winston-Salem and south of Kernersville, is a burgeoning suburban neighborhood characterized by recent construction and a low turnover rate. The area features a mix of newly built homes and more established houses, with architectural styles ranging from ranch-style and farmhouse-inspired Craftsman homes to larger, older properties on bigger plots. The neighborhood is known for its quiet streets, which, despite lacking sidewalks, see minimal through traffic, making them suitable for walking and jogging. Oak Garden is part of the highly rated Winston Salem/Forsyth County School District, which is recognized for its diversity. Local amenities include the Ivey M. Redmond Sports Complex, offering multi-use fields, and Fourth of July Park, which features walking trails, tennis courts, and a skate park. The annual Honeybee Festival and the Paul J. Ciener Botanical Garden are notable local events and attractions. Residents have access to a small shopping center with a Food Lion and local restaurants, while larger retail options are available in nearby Kernersville. With no public transportation, residents rely on cars for commuting, facilitated by the neighborhood's proximity to U.S. Interstate 40. The nearest major hospital, North Carolina Baptist Hospital, is 10 miles away, and the largest airport is 18 miles east. Oak Garden has a lower crime risk compared to the national average, contributing to its appeal as a growing suburban enclave.
